UF Health Shands Hospital, a U.S. News & World Report top-ranked children’s hospital, recently completed a study which took place in six nursing units, evaluating the impact of AccuVein vein visualization on the number of times it was necessary to escalate a PIV start to central resource staff.
Study results showed a 45% reduction in escalation calls following the implementation of the AccuVein AV400, with 91% of nurses reporting likelihood to use the device prior to escalating call. In addition 81% of the nurses surveyed reported an improved ability to cannulate veins. The data from this analysis was displayed at the Infusion Nurses Society 2014 Annual Convention that took place in May.
